Exam Overview

The Professional Practice for Interior Design Test is a crucial step for aspiring interior designers aiming to achieve licensure or certification. Administered by various states or certification bodies, this exam evaluates the knowledge and skills required for competent practice in the field. It serves as a gateway for professionals who wish to transform creative visions into functional and aesthetically pleasing interior spaces.

What to Expect on the Exam

Topics Covered:

The exam encompasses a broad range of topics that are fundamental to the practice of interior design. Key areas include:

  • Design Process: Understanding client needs, space planning, and design development.
  • Building Systems: Insights into HVAC, electrical systems, and plumbing.
  • Codes and Standards: Familiarity with building codes, safety regulations, and ADA standards.
  • Project Management: Budgeting, scheduling, and managing design projects.
  • Professional Practice: Ethics, legal issues, and business practices in interior design.

Exam Format:

The Professional Practice for Interior Design Test usually consists of multiple-choice questions, but may include case studies and scenario-based questions requiring critical thinking. The number of questions and passing score may vary depending on the administering body. Candidates should verify specific details with their local certification board. A general breakdown may include:

  • Multiple-Choice Questions: Assess foundational knowledge across various topics.
  • Time Allocation: Typically, candidates are given around 3 to 4 hours to complete the exam.

Understanding the format allows candidates to manage their time efficiently and strategize their approach to the questions.

What are the eligibility requirements to sit for the Interior Design Exam?

Eligibility generally involves having a combination of education and practical experience. Most candidates hold a degree in interior design and complete an internship. It's advisable to confirm specific requirements with your local licensing board to ensure compliance.
